Department Bio - The GW Department of Philosophy is a research-active, congenial group, with over 20 full- and part-time faculty members who are pluralistic in training. Our departmental expertise spans both continental and analytic traditions, with courses exploring the many facets of philosophy, from ethics to legal applications; environmental philosophy to the philosophy of race, gender and disability. Our faculty have served on the President's Council on Bioethics, researched with the National Institute for Health and offered advisory support at the Census Bureau.

Position Specific Summary - The student will be the first point of contact for visitors to the Philosophy Department. Tasks will include: greeting visitors, responding to in person and phone inquiries, providing customer service to other students, faculty, and staff; directing inquiries to the appropriate resources as needed; and assisting with other office tasks. The department will host several visiting lecturers in the fall and spring semesters, usually on Friday afternoons. The student may be asked to help with coordinating catering delivery and/or pickup, coordinating guest seating, attending the lectures, and breaking down the catering set-up after the event. In addition, Philosophy professors may ask the administrative assistant to assist with photocopies or other tasks related to organizing their research materials.

Standard Position Description - The student will serve as an administrative assistant and perform tasks to support the operations of the office or department. Tasks may include: assembling materials, filing, photocopying, giving directions or information, responding to phone or email inquiries, scanning and indexing documents, light data entry, and other general office tasks. Special projects or duties may be assigned related to specific office needs.

George Washington University (GWU) is not a traditional company, but an esteemed hub of higher education nestled in the heart of Washington, DC, US. Established in 1821 through an Act of Congress, fulfilling George Washington's vision of an institution in the nation's capital dedicated to educating future leaders. Within the education sector, the university provides a range of products and services, such as undergraduate degrees, graduate degrees, and various research programs across diverse disciplines. The university is guided by the core values of learning, communication, community, diversity, excellence, respect, service, and teamwork.
